What happened in the year 1756?

Date Event
February 7, 1756 Guaraní War: The leader of the Guaraní rebels, Sepé Tiaraju, is killed in a skirmish with Spanish and Portuguese troops.
May 17, 1756 Seven Years' War formally begins when Great Britain declares war on France
May 18, 1756 The Seven Years' War begins when Great Britain declares war on France.
June 20, 1756 A British garrison is imprisoned in the Black Hole of Calcutta.
July 30, 1756 In Saint Petersburg, Bartolomeo Rastrelli presents the newly built Catherine Palace to Empress Elizabeth and her courtiers.
August 29, 1756 Frederick the Great attacks Saxony, beginning the Seven Years' War in Europe.
September 8, 1756 French and Indian War: Kittanning Expedition.
